The shoreline of Lake Superior around the area is usually open water most of the winter. In the last few weeks however, ice has settled in massive amounts. Our food vendor Ed ventured out on the ice to snap this seldom seen look at the main lodge from out on ice. Several of our guests were also out there too. These people are truly some brave souls.
